In the evening, enjoy Kathakali Dance Performance – the riveting 400-year-old drama of Kerala that narrates sequences from Indian religious epic, the Ramayana and the Mahabharata.
The make up for the dance starts at 1730hrs in the evening which is the most interesting part and it lasts till 1830hrs. The makeup is very elaborate, and the costumes are large and heavy. The makeup is so elaborate that it is more like a mask than makeup in the usual sense. The materials that comprise the makeup is locally available. The white is made from rice flour, the red is made from Vermilion (a red earth such as cinnabar).
